What Does a Supplemental Insurance Agent in Syracuse Cost?

Supplemental insurance costs in Utah vary by plan type age and health status. Medigap Plan G premiums for a 65 year old in Syracuse typically range from 120 to 200 dollars per month. Medicare Advantage plans often have low or zero monthly premiums but may have higher out of pocket costs.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a supplemental insurance agent in Syracuse Utah?
A supplemental insurance agent helps you buy policies that cover costs not paid by original Medicare or employer plans. These agents are licensed in Utah and can explain Medigap Medicare Advantage and hospital indemnity plans. They work with multiple carriers to find a policy that fits your needs.
What types of supplemental insurance are common in Syracuse Utah?
Common plans include Medicare Supplement Medigap Medicare Advantage and stand-alone dental or vision policies. Some residents also buy accident or critical illness insurance. Utah allows guaranteed issue Medigap plans during certain enrollment periods.
How do I choose a supplemental insurance agent in Syracuse Utah?
Look for an agent who is licensed by the Utah Insurance Department and has experience with Medicare rules. Ask about the number of carriers they represent. You can verify a license on the Utah Insurance Department website.
